European Maritime Day events in my country aim to raise awareness of the importance of the oceans and seas and engage the public, especially young people. The goal is to raise awareness that maritime activities (coastal tourism, fishing, sailing, navigation, offshore renewable energy, aquaculture, etc.) are fundamental to EU citizens and economies.
